Python虚拟环境与真实环境以及PIP基础使用

目录

目录

一、Python的真实环境

1、真实环境是指系统全局的 Python 环境。

2、需要自己安装Python311,312,313解释器不同版本

3、不能直接使用

二、Python的虚拟环境

特点:

1、克隆出来的空的解释器(依赖真实环境)

2、每一个项目都要有一个独立的虚拟环境

3、一个解释器同时只能安装一个模块的版本                                                           

三、创建和使用虚拟环境(终端输入)

1、创建虚拟环境

二、创建完成之后会有一个myenv文件夹

1、激活虚拟环境

2、按enter之后进入虚拟环境

3、退出虚拟环境​编辑

PIP 基础使用

 卸载包

 列出已安装的包(pip list)

显示包信息​编辑

四、总结

 1、真实环境:

系统全局的 Python 环境,适合单个项目或不需要隔离的开发场景。                   

 2、虚拟环境:

独立的 Python 环境,适合多项目开发,避免包冲突,便于项目部署和迁移。     

 3、pip:

Python 的包管理工具,用于安装、更新和管理第三方库。

通过合理使用虚拟环境和 pip,可以有效管理项目依赖,确保开发环境的稳定性和一致性。


一、Python的真实环境

1、真实环境是指系统全局的 Python 环境。

当你在系统中安装 Python 时,它会创建一个全局的 Python 环境,所有全局安装的包都会存储在这个环境中。

2、需要自己安装Python311,312,313解释器不同版本

3、不能直接使用

二、Python的虚拟环境

虚拟环境是一个独立的 Python 环境,它允许你在不同的项目中使用不同的包版本,而不会相互干扰。虚拟环境是通过 venv 模块(Python 3.3+)或 virtualenv 工具创建的。

特点:

1、克隆出来的空的解释器(依赖真实环境)

2、每一个项目都要有一个独立的虚拟环境

3、一个解释器同时只能安装一个模块的版本                                                           

三、创建和使用虚拟环境(终端输入)

1、创建虚拟环境

Python -m venv 虚拟环境的名字

二、创建完成之后会有一个myenv文件夹

1、激活虚拟环境

2、按enter之后进入虚拟环境

3、退出虚拟环境

PIP 基础使用

pip 是 Python 的包管理工具,用于安装、更新和管理第三方库。以下是一些常用的 pip 命令:
    默认从国外镜像下载,特别慢
    建议更改为国内镜像源

 卸载包

 列出已安装的包(pip list)

显示包信息


四、总结

 1、真实环境:

系统全局的 Python 环境,适合单个项目或不需要隔离的开发场景。                   

 2、虚拟环境:

独立的 Python 环境,适合多项目开发,避免包冲突,便于项目部署和迁移。     

 3、pip

Python 的包管理工具,用于安装、更新和管理第三方库。

通过合理使用虚拟环境和 pip,可以有效管理项目依赖,确保开发环境的稳定性和一致性。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值